Subject: Garagesense occupancy feed — release 7.3

Team, release 7.3 of the Garagesense occupancy feed for the Northvale deck is live. This fixes the stale-count issue where sensors in levels three and four lagged by up to ninety seconds. Support: if customers report mismatched counts after today, confirm their dashboard shows the new version before escalating, since cached clients may linger for an hour. For verification, the build token for this release follows.

pipeline stamp: htk31_f769b577b3028a4e9958e5bb8d1259a

Subject: Handover — cron drift follow-up

Hi all,

Wrapping up the cron drift investigation on the Pellmont build hosts before I rotate off. Root cause was an unsynced clock on runner four; jobs fired late but produced valid artifacts. New folks: re-sign anything built during the drift window and verify before promotion. Verification uses the release key directly below this line.

signing key of yajog-kafof = bky19_orbYRY3Abj3KpZesMie

Digest jobs in Mailgrove run from a single scheduler worker that reads per-tenant cadence settings (hourly, daily, weekly) from the config store. Tenants can only adjust cadence through the admin console, which enforces role checks and writes an audit record. The scheduler itself has no inbound network exposure and pulls work via an internal queue. For questions about the audit trail or queue permissions during your review, contact the messaging platform owners at the address below.

alerts address for bajop-yahog: istwyn@lumiclabs.internal

**Action item (PM-2291):** The digest scheduler double-sent batch emails because two cron workers grabbed the same window. Fix is to add a lease lock per digest window — small change, but please review the lock TTL carefully since windows can run long. Context, timeline, and the proposed locking scheme are all written up on the incident page here.

operations page: https://jenkins.zemvarcloud.local/job/merge_requests/repo/build/73930b4b30f0a8ed